About the climbing:

Great climbing, only about 80 foot routes some 100 footers. We did a couple of classics while I was there. Two outstanding routes that we did were Passages a 5.8 and Golden Locks a 5.8+. Golden Locks is a pure hand crack. If you like crack you'll love Golden Locks. A must do!!!!

Plastic Toys 5.7 has a nice opening move. 10 foot boulder that you need to step off of onto the face.

The rock is sandstone but not desert sandstone. Takes a little getting used to if you never climbed on it before but you get the hang of it fairly quickly.
